Broker violations and abnormal records
  • Jun 06, 2024 BaFin issues warning against Bit Wise

    On June 7, 2024, the Federal Financial Supervisory Authority (BaFin) warned consumers about Bit-Wise and its services. BaFin has information that the company offers banking and/or financial services on its website without the necessary authorization. The company is not supervised by BaFin. https://www.bafin.de/SharedDocs/Veroeffentlichungen/EN/Verbrauchermitteilung/unerlaubte/2024/meldung_2024_06_07_bit-wise_co_en.html

  • Jun 13, 2024 BrokersView has reviewed that Bit Wise is an unregulated broker.

    Bit Wise fails to provide specific regulatory information to support its legitimacy, which is a clear indicator of a scam. Despite claiming to have offices in the UK, US, and Switzerland, there is no indication that it is registered with the relevant financial regulators in any of these countries. This indicates it operates in an unregulated environment.

    In addition, the Federal Financial Supervisory Authority (BaFin) has issued a warning against Bit Wise, stating that Bit-Wise offers banking business and/or financial services on its website without the necessary authorization and highlighting that the company is not supervised by BaFin.

    Essentially, Bit Wise is not regulated by any government agency. Entrusting it with investor funds is extremely risky, as there are no legal safeguards in place to protect them.

    Bit Wise appears to be a scam.

  • Jan 12, 2025 Bit Wise changes its domain name to avoid accountability

    Bit Wise has deactivated its previous domain name, bit-wise.co, and is now using the new domain name, bitwise-pro.com. The Federal Financial Supervisory Authority (BaFin) has noticed this change and updated its warning about Bit Wise. https://www.bafin.de/SharedDocs/Veroeffentlichungen/EN/Verbrauchermitteilung/unerlaubte/2025/meldung_2025_01_08_bitwise_pro_com_en.html

  • Aug 20, 2025 BrokersView has identified that the Bit Wise website is currently offline

    BrokersView found that the domains "https://www.bitwise-pro.com/en/" and "https://www.bit-wise.co/" are currently inaccessible. This is widely considered a significant red flag, as broker website suspensions often indicate underlying regulatory or operational issues.
